Identifying Orthodontic Emergencies
When examining orthodontic emergencies, try to find indications of discomfort, swelling, or damaged home appliances. Pain can indicate various problems such as a broken cord jabbing your cheek or a loosened brace causing discomfort. Swelling might be a sign of infection or an injury calling for instant interest. Damaged devices, like loosened bands or cables, can cause more complications otherwise addressed quickly. Keep an eye out for these signs and symptoms to recognize prospective emergencies and act accordingly.
An additional critical element to think about is any sudden changes in your bite or problem chewing. These could indicate an extra severe issue that requires immediate care. Furthermore, if you experience any uncommon blood loss from your gum tissues or discover sores in your mouth that aren't healing, it's important to seek specialist aid quickly.
Immediate Tips for Relief
To ease discomfort from orthodontic emergency situations, without delay wash your mouth with cozy seawater to help reduce pain and swelling. This basic service can offer immediate alleviation for different concerns, such as mouth sores, minor cuts from dental braces, or general soreness. Carefully swishing the salt water around your mouth for concerning 30 seconds prior to spitting it out can aid cleanse the location and decrease swelling.
If you're experiencing irritability from cords or braces, using orthodontic wax to the bothersome area can develop a safety barrier between the metal and your gums or cheeks. This can prevent additional irritability and permit your mouth to heal more pleasantly.
In cases of a protruding wire that's causing discomfort, you can attempt making use of a cotton swab or the eraser end of a pencil to very carefully push the cord into an extra comfy position. Be gentle to prevent causing even more damages or discomfort. These immediate actions can supply momentary relief until you can see your orthodontist for a more long-term solution.
Contacting Your Orthodontist
If you're experiencing an orthodontic emergency situation, without delay call your orthodontist for advice and support. Your orthodontist is the most effective source to aid you browse through any type of immediate issues with your braces or aligners. This info will assist your orthodontist in determining the severity of the situation and giving you with ideal advice.
Whether it's during workplace hours or after, many orthodontic techniques have procedures in place to manage emergency situations. They may arrange you for a same-day appointment or offer guidelines on how to handle the concern till you can be seen. By calling your orthodontist without delay, you can avoid additional complications and reduce any kind of discomfort you might be experiencing.
